The Growing Role of Wearable Technology
Wearable devices have evolved far beyond simple step counters. Modern smartwatches now offer advanced features such as heart rate monitoring, sleep analysis, GPS tracking, and even contactless payments. These capabilities allow users to stay informed about their health and activities without needing to constantly check their smartphones. As a result, wearables have become indispensable for athletes, professionals, and casual users alike.

Balancing Comfort and Style
One of the most noticeable ways to personalise a wearable device is through its strap. The choice of material can significantly affect how the device feels throughout the day. For example, silicone straps are often favoured for sports and outdoor activities due to their flexibility and resistance to sweat. Leather options, on the other hand, provide a more refined and classic appearance suitable for formal settings.
The ability to switch between styles means that a single device can adapt to multiple environments. A runner might prefer a lightweight, breathable strap during training sessions, while opting for something more elegant when attending a social event. This versatility ensures that the device remains both functional and aesthetically pleasing at all times.
